One other thing. The CD drive for the radio is between the seats where the storage compartment is.

So, whether you want to grab something out of the storage compartment, or oddly enough, you want to swap CDs out while driving, you're going to be doing it blind and in an awkward manner. And if you do decide to use your eyes to do so, you'll be doing so at higher risk than just glancing down to the passenger side of the car.

As is, it doesn't seem like the ND is going to be aftermarket radio friendly at all.
